PRA INTRODUCES CARBON CALCULATION TOOL TO AID CLIENTS IN REDUCING COSTS AND MANAGING ENERGY CONSUMPTION AND EMISSIONS FOR ALL TRANSPORTATION PROGRAMS

 

SAN FRANCISCO, July 9 – PRA Destination Management, Inc., a leading destination management company, announced today the addition of a progressive tool for its client base to calculate the carbon footprint of each transportation program, according to James W. Hensley, chief executive officer of Allied International, parent company of PRA Destination Management, Inc.

 

PRA Destination Management is the first DMC to offer this valuable tool to its client base, as a courtesy and value-added benefit for all its transportation programs. By utilizing this calculation tool, PRA clients can base mark their carbon footing as it relates to all bus, limo and shuttle service programs in an effort to help reduce costs and manage energy consumption and emissions.

 

"Greenhouse gases and environmental impacts are top-of-mind for businesses today and carbon calculation markings are going to be part of most program portfolios in the future," Hensley said. "By offering this calculation tool, we can directly assist our clients with understanding their impact on the environment and costs associated with it, creating an economic value for all stakeholders, while continuing to be mindful of our environmental impacts associated with transportation programs we conduct on behalf of PRA clients."

 

A carbon footprint is measured by one's energy consumption and how those choices impact the environment and climate change. By measuring the amount of greenhouse gases produced in day-to-day activities through the burning of fossil fuels for electricity, heating and transportation, an individual or company can set a baseline carbon calculation mark and participate in carbon offsetting programs that can improve upon the carbon footprint for future usage.

 

The carbon footprint program officially launches this month in the PRA San Francisco region and will be PRA system-wide by month's end. Through a partnership with its local transportation vendors, PRA San Francisco will be the first DMC in the market to offer this value-added program.

 

"PRA San Francisco is thrilled to be the first DMC to provide this forward-thinking tool for our clients," said Ferris Suér, co-principal owner of PRA San Francisco. "By providing this carbon calculation baseline, as well as recommendations for energy reduction transportation solutions, we can aid our clients in drastically reducing greenhouse gases, emissions and associated costs. We look forward to incorporating this valuable tool in other elements of PRA service programs."
